fre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

單片機課程設計---8段2位數(shù)碼led掃描輸出(編輯修改稿)

2025-06-26 15:17 本頁面
 

【文章內(nèi)容簡介】 ; ⑤ 在單片機電源端加接濾波電容 (100uF,); ⑥ 若上述均無誤 ,則更換單片機 . 功能測試 程序必須首先在 PC 機上模擬通過 檢查時序,邏輯關系 檢查關鍵變量 檢查執(zhí)行流程 燒寫單片機,硬件驗證 使用 LED 測試 使用串口調(diào)試 設計步驟 首先要根據(jù)系統(tǒng)設計及其他有關資料,弄清楚該程序設計的條件和設計要求,如:硬件、軟件的狀況和采用的語言、編碼、輸入、輸出、文件設 置、數(shù)據(jù)處理等方面的要求,以及本程序和其他各項程序之間的關系等。 必須要對處理的進行仔細的分析,弄清楚數(shù)據(jù)的詳細內(nèi)容和特點之后,才能進一步按照要求確定數(shù)據(jù)的數(shù)量和層次結(jié)構(gòu),安排輸入、輸出。存儲、加工處理的步驟以及一些具體的計算方法。 確定流程是為了完成規(guī)定的任務而給計算機安排的具體操作步驟一般用統(tǒng)一的符號把數(shù)據(jù)的輸入、輸出、存儲、加工等處理過程繪制成流程圖(簡稱框圖),作為編寫程序的依據(jù)。 編寫程序是采用一種程序設計語言,按其規(guī)定的語言規(guī)則 把確定的流程描寫出來。 檢查內(nèi)容包括程序結(jié)構(gòu)是否得當,語句的選用和組織是否合理,語法是否符號規(guī)定,語義是否正確等。一個程序往往要經(jīng)過反復多次的調(diào)試:運行、檢查、修改,之后才能通過。 6. 編寫課程設計報告 電路硬件圖 8 段 2 位數(shù)碼 LED 掃描輸出(顯示控制輸入) 工作原理圖 0 |方案設計 方案確定 購買元器件 焊接電路 硬件調(diào)試 軟件編程 聯(lián)合調(diào)試 寫說明書 軟件仿真 AT89C51 單片機系統(tǒng) MAX232 芯片系統(tǒng) 7. 程序流程圖 開始時先初始化顯示程序,接著分別顯示子程序或某單元驅(qū)動子程序,最后返回。 主程序流程圖 8. 實驗源程序 注: 程序老師已經(jīng)寫好 學生只需將程序讀入單片機即可 原 8 段 2 位數(shù)碼 LED 掃描輸出(顯示控制輸入)程序如下: 這是一種比較笨但又最易理解的方法,采用順序程序結(jié)構(gòu),用位指令控 制 P1 口的每一個位輸出高低電平,從而來控制相應 LED 燈的亮滅。程序如下: KEY BIT 。按鍵位 HB BIT 。數(shù)碼管高位 LB BIT 。數(shù)碼管低位 FLAG BIT 00H 。標志位 ORG 00H START: JB KEY,S1 。判斷按鍵是高電平還是低電平 MOV DPTR,TABLE1 。如果是低電平 ,置 12345顯示碼首地址 CLR FLAG LJMP S2 S1: MOV DPTR,TABLE2 。如果是高電平 ,置 HELLO顯示碼首地址 SETB FLAG S2: MOV R0,00H 。數(shù)碼管高位顯示碼偏移地址 MOV R1,01H 。數(shù)碼管低位顯示碼偏移地址 K1: MOV R7,100 。延時常數(shù)
點擊復制文檔內(nèi)容
畢業(yè)設計相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1